Our UI Developer Training program offers a comprehensive and hands-on exploration of the art and science of user interface (UI) design and development. Whether you’re a beginner looking to enter the world of UI design or an experienced developer aiming to enhance your UI skills, this program provides the knowledge and practical experience you need to become a proficient UI developer.


User interface design is a critical component of creating engaging and user-friendly digital experiences. In this training program, you’ll learn the principles of effective UI design, gain proficiency in front-end technologies, and develop the skills to create visually appealing and responsive user interfaces. Whether you’re interested in web or mobile UI development, this program equips you with the tools to create stunning and intuitive user interfaces.

“UI developers are the artists of the web, using their creativity and technical skills to craft visually stunning and user-friendly interfaces.”Chris Coyier, Founder of CSS-Tricks

Here is a comprehensive list of course topics for a UI Developer Training program

Module 1: Introduction to UI Development
  1. Introduction to User Interface (UI) Design and Development
  2. Role of a UI Developer in the Software Development Process
  3. Overview of Front-End Development Technologies
Module 2: UI Design Principles and Fundamentals
  1. Understanding User-Centered Design (UCD) Principles
  2. Visual Hierarchy and Layout Design
  3. Color Theory and Typography in UI Design
  4. User Experience (UX) Design and Usability
Module 3: HTML and CSS Fundamentals
  1. Introduction to HTML5 and its Semantic Elements
  2. Cascading Style Sheets (CSS) Basics and Selectors
  3. CSS Box Model and Layout Techniques
  4. Responsive Web Design and Media Queries
Module 4: Advanced CSS and Preprocessors
  1. CSS Flexbox and Grid Layouts
  2. Introduction to CSS Preprocessors (e.g., Sass, Less)
  3. Using Preprocessors for Efficient Styling
Module 5: JavaScript for UI Development
  1. Introduction to JavaScript and its Role in UI Development
  2. Document Object Model (DOM) Manipulation
  3. Event Handling and Interactivity
  4. Client-Side Form Validation
Module 6: UI Frameworks and Libraries
  1. Introduction to UI Frameworks (e.g., Bootstrap, Material Design)
  2. Building Responsive and Mobile-Friendly UIs
  3. Using UI Components and Widgets
Module 7: Web Accessibility and Inclusive Design
  1. Understanding Web Accessibility Guidelines (WCAG)
  2. Designing for Different User Needs and Abilities
  3. Testing and Ensuring Accessibility in UIs
Module 8: UI Design Tools and Prototyping
  1. Introduction to UI Design Tools (e.g., Adobe XD, Sketch)
  2. Creating Wireframes, Mockups, and Prototypes
  3. Interactive Prototyping and User Testing
Module 9: UI Animation and Interaction Design
  1. Principles of UI Animation and Microinteractions
  2. Implementing CSS Animations and Transitions
  3. Adding JavaScript Interactivity and Animation
Module 10: UI Development for Mobile Platforms
  1. Mobile UI Design Guidelines and Best Practices
  2. Responsive Design for Mobile Devices
  3. Building Mobile Apps with Web Technologies
Module 11: Performance Optimization for UIs
  1. Techniques for Optimizing UI Performance
  2. Minification and Compression of Web Assets
  3. Lazy Loading and Resource Prioritization
Module 12: Version Control and Collaboration
  1. Introduction to Version Control with Git
  2. Collaborative Workflows and Branching Strategies
  3. Version Control for UI Development Projects
Module 13: UI Development Project

Applying Concepts Learned to Design and Develop a Complete UI Project

Real Time Projects Overview - UI Developer Training

Embark on a journey of practical application with our immersive real-time projects, a vital part of our UI Developer Training. These projects are thoughtfully designed to provide you with hands-on experience and a deeper understanding of building engaging and responsive user interfaces. With each project spanning 55 hours, you’ll accumulate a total of 110 hours of immersive project work throughout the course, equipping you with invaluable skills for crafting exceptional user experiences.

Project 1: Interactive E-Commerce Website Project 2: Web Application Redesign

In this project, you'll create an interactive e-commerce website that delivers a seamless user experience. You'll design captivating user interfaces, implement responsive layouts, integrate product catalogs, and enhance user engagement through dynamic features. By the end of this project, you'll have a fully functional e-commerce website that showcases your expertise in UI design and development.

In this project, you'll revamp an existing web application to enhance its usability and aesthetics. You'll analyze user feedback, redesign the user interface, optimize performance, and implement modern design principles. This project will demonstrate your ability to transform and elevate user interfaces to meet contemporary standards.

The UI Developer Training program exceeded my expectations. The curriculum covered both design principles and front-end technologies, allowing me to create visually appealing and functional user interfaces. The hands-on projects were engaging and educational."
UI Developer

